Inverse Variation
  • Inverse is very similar to direct, but in an
    inverse relationship as one value goes up, the
    other goes down.
  • Can you think of an example
  • Of this happening?

14
Inverse Variation
  • With Direct variation we Divide our xs and ys.
  • In Inverse variation we will Multiply them.
  • x1y1 x2y2

15
Inverse Variation
  • If y varies inversely with x and y 12 when x
    2, find y when x 8.
  • x1y1 x2y2
  • 2(12) 8y
  • 24 8y
  • y 3

Inverse Variation
  • If y varies inversely as x and x 18 when y 6,
    find y when x 8.
  • 18(6) 8y
  • 108 8y
  • y 13.5

Example
  • If it takes 3 carpenters to frame a house in 8
    weeks, how many weeks will it take four
    carpenters to frame the same house?
  • (3)(8) (4)(w)
  • W 6
